SERVICE HISTORY:
1994 & 1999 the struts have been replaced. Original suspension except Hor Technologie Springs to lower the car.
1998 New cylinder head from the dealership - Never, ever drive your Corrado hot! The original paper headgasket contributed to this.
1998 Upgraded to TEC GT1 (G83). The orig. G60 had over 200K miles on it.
